Let''s take a walk back, shall we? The original Burberry London for Women, launched in 2006, was an instant classic. It was a bold, beautiful white floral that perfectly encapsulated the brand’s modern British identity. It was the scent of a confident, chic Londoner navigating the bustling city. Then, as brands often do with their pillars, Burberry began to play. They released limited editions, little olfactory postcards that offered a new perspective on the original masterpiece. This particular Special Edition, which I believe is the 2008 version, wasn''t a radical reinvention. Instead, it felt like a different time of day, a different mood. It was the original''s romantic, slightly more wistful younger sister.

The concept was simple yet deeply evocative: to capture the unique charm of London in bloom, just after a spring or autumn shower. It’s that magical moment when the air is clean and charged, the colors of the parks are impossibly vivid, and the city feels both fresh and ancient. While the original was a statement, this edition is a whisper. It’s less about the high-energy pulse of Regent Street and more about a quiet stroll through Kensington Gardens, a stolen moment of peace amidst the urban symphony.

In the fragrance community, these special editions are like collector''s items. They are hunted down on resale sites, cherished by those who were lucky enough to grab a bottle during their brief run. This one, in particular, holds a special place because it softened the original''s powerful tuberose and jasmine heart, making it more approachable, more luminous, and dare I say, more poetic. The Nose Behind the Scent

The original creation, which forms the backbone of this special edition, was composed by the masterful duo Dominique Ropion and Jean-Marc Chaillan. Ropion is a living legend in perfumery, known for his technically precise yet emotionally powerful creations like Frédéric Malle Portrait of a Lady and Viktor&Rolf Flowerbomb.

Scent Journey

1
Opening 0-30 min

A bright, sparkling burst of optimism. The grapefruit is juicy and effervescent, lifted by a hint of spicy pink pepper and the tartness of black currant. It''s like the first ray of sun after a morning shower – clean, crisp, and invigorating.

2
Heart 1-2 hrs

The heart is a romantic, dewy floral bouquet. The initial zestiness softens, allowing a modern, fresh rose and soft peony to bloom on the skin. It doesn''t scream ''floral''; it whispers. It’s elegant, feminine, and has a gentle, watercolor-like quality.

3
Drydown 4+ hrs

The final phase is a soft, comforting embrace. A clean, skin-like musk blends with a very refined, non-earthy patchouli and a smooth, polished mahogany wood note. It becomes a sophisticated, warm skin scent that feels personal and incredibly chic.

Performance Dashboard

⏱️ Longevity 3.8/5

Lasts a solid 5-6 hours on skin, fading into a beautiful, soft whisper. It''s not an all-day beast, but its presence is felt for a full workday or an afternoon out.

📢 Projection 3.2/5

Projects moderately for the first 1-2 hours, creating a personal scent bubble of about arm''s length. It''s noticeable without being intrusive.

💨 Sillage 3.0/5

Leaves a soft, delicate trail. This is a scent that invites people closer rather than announcing your arrival from afar. It''s elegant and understated.
